Bristol Academy chasing a place in last eight

Bristol Academy will be setting their sights on a place in the last eight of the FA Women's Cup when they take on Birmingham City at Oaklands Park, Almondsbury on Sunday (2pm).

Gary Green's side finally settled their fourth-round clash at Watford last weekend at the third time of asking when they won 3-1 after two weather-induced postponements.

All the goals came in the last quarter of the game. Kerry Bartlett put the visitors ahead before Lisa Burrows levelled. But Bartlett struck again and Justine Lorton put the outcome beyond doubt with a third.

Academy coach Green said: "We were missing a few players – Gwen Harries and Kerry Manley through injuries, while Michelle Green was not ready to return and Grace McCatty was suspended.

"Hopefully, we will have at least a couple of them back for Sunday.

"There was a real buzz around the place after we beat Watford – it was our first away win this season.

"Now, hopefully, we can get through on Sunday. We beat Birmingham 4-2 at home earlier in the season, although we lost 2-1 at their place."

The weather again wiped out a fair proportion of the local programme last weekend, although there were big wins for Yeovil Town and Forest Green Rovers in the SW Combination.

Four goals from Phili Helliwell and Charlotte King's hat-trick gave Forest Green a 7-2 win at Oxford City, while Anusia Rourke's treble – plus goals from Jemma Tewkesbury and Kayleigh Nardiello – secured Yeovil's 5-0 trouncing of Swindon Town.

Weston St Johns' clash with leaders QPR was among the clutch of postponed fixtures.
